Case Summary: SLP(C) No. 3430-3431/2005 On 25/02/2005, the Supreme Court heard BHART S. NIGAM LTD.'s petition against SINCLAIR INFRA TECH LTD. challenging a High Court order. The Court identified an arguable question of law overlooked by the High Court: whether reciprocal obligations under an Award can be enforced unilaterally. The Court stayed execution of the Award and directed the High Court to dispose of both the main appeal and civil revision petition within three months. The interim stay continues until the High Court's disposal, though respondent may still seek execution as per Award terms. The SLPs were disposed of.
